From 8ddc7f5ecc67c0bb424954a86b75ec7444080ba2 Mon Sep 17 00:00:00 2001 From: Administrator <admin@example.com> Date: 星期三, 29 三月 2023 18:02:50 +0800 Subject: [PATCH] 首板买入策略分值优化 --- third_data/hot_block.py | 9 +++++++-- 1 files changed, 7 insertions(+), 2 deletions(-) diff --git a/third_data/hot_block.py b/third_data/hot_block.py index 9ddfb71..da1783b 100644 --- a/third_data/hot_block.py +++ b/third_data/hot_block.py @@ -12,6 +12,7 @@ def __parseData(driver): + time_ele = driver.find_element(by=By.TAG_NAME, value="time") date_element = \ driver.find_element(by=By.ID, value="nuxt-layout-container").find_elements(by=By.TAG_NAME, value="time")[0] date_elements = date_element.find_elements(by=By.TAG_NAME, value="span") @@ -42,6 +43,7 @@ codes_list = [] for content in contents: tds = content.find_elements(by=By.TAG_NAME, value="td") + code_name = tds[0].find_elements(by=By.TAG_NAME, value="span")[0].text code = tds[0].find_elements(by=By.TAG_NAME, value="span")[1].text limit_up_info = tds[1].text price = tds[2].text @@ -49,7 +51,7 @@ limit_up_time = tds[4].text huanshou = tds[5].text ltsz = tds[6].text - codes_list.append((code, limit_up_info, price, rate, limit_up_time, huanshou, ltsz)) + codes_list.append(((code_name, code), limit_up_info, price, rate, limit_up_time, huanshou, ltsz)) data_list.append((title, total_rate, codes_list)) print("----------------------") @@ -68,10 +70,13 @@ time.sleep(5) while True: time.sleep(3) - # 浜ゆ槗鏃堕棿鎵嶈瘑鍒� time_str = datetime.datetime.now().strftime("%H%M%S") + # 浜ゆ槗鏃堕棿鎵嶈瘑鍒� # if int(time_str) < int("092500") or int(time_str) > int("150000"): # continue + # 姣忓ぉ9鐐�25鍒�9鐐�26鍒锋柊 + if int("092500") < int(time_str) < int("092700"): + driver.refresh() # if int("113000") < int(time_str) < int("130000"): # continue try: -- Gitblit v1.8.0